&lt;h2&gt;
  
  
  The Code, It's Stupidly Simple
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Step 1: Define Typed Input/Output Classes
&lt;/h3&gt;

&lt;p&gt;Instead of using raw &lt;code&gt;Map&lt;/code&gt; or &lt;code&gt;String&lt;/code&gt;, define proper Java classes with Jackson annotations. Genkit uses these annotations to generate JSON schemas that tell Gemini exactly what structure to return.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;&lt;code&gt;TranslateRequest.java&lt;/code&gt;&lt;/strong&gt;, the flow input: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ight java"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;com.fasterxml.jackson.annotation.JsonProperty&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;com.fasterxml.jackson.annotation.J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

&lt;span class="cm"&gt;/**
 * Input for the translate flow.
 */&lt;/span&gt;
&l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;TranslateRequest&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;

    &lt;span class="nd"&gt;@JsonProperty&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;required&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="nd"&gt;@J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"The text to translate"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="kd"&gt;private&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

    &lt;span class="nd"&gt;@JsonProperty&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;required&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="nd"&gt;@J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"The target language (e.g., Spanish, French, Japanese)"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="kd"&gt;private&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nf"&gt;TranslateRequest&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nf"&gt;TranslateRequest&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;text&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;language&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;getText&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kt"&gt;void&lt;/span&gt; &lt;span class="nf"&gt;setText&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;text&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;getLanguage&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kt"&gt;void&lt;/span&gt; &lt;span class="nf"&gt;setLanguage&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;language&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="nd"&gt;@Override&lt;/span&gt;
    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;toString&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;format&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"TranslateRequest{text='%s', language='%s'}"&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;);&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;
&lt;span class="o"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;&lt;code&gt;TranslateResponse.java&lt;/code&gt;&lt;/strong&gt;, the flow output &lt;em&gt;and&lt;/em&gt; the LLM structured output: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ight java"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;com.fasterxml.jackson.annotation.JsonProperty&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;com.fasterxml.jackson.annotation.J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

&lt;span class="cm"&gt;/**
 * Structured output for the translate flow.
 */&lt;/span&gt;
&l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kd"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;TranslateResponse&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;

    &lt;span class="nd"&gt;@JsonProperty&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;required&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="nd"&gt;@J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"The original text that was translated"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="kd"&gt;private&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

    &lt;span class="nd"&gt;@JsonProperty&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;required&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="nd"&gt;@J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"The translated text"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="kd"&gt;private&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

    &lt;span class="nd"&gt;@JsonProperty&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;required&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="nd"&gt;@JsonPropertyDescription&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"The target language"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="kd"&gt;private&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nf"&gt;TranslateResponse&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nf"&gt;TranslateResponse&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;originalText&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;translatedText&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;language&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;getOriginalText&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kt"&gt;void&lt;/span&gt; &lt;span class="nf"&gt;setOriginalText&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;originalText&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;getTranslatedText&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kt"&gt;void&lt;/span&gt; &lt;span class="nf"&gt;setTranslatedText&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;translatedText&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;getLanguage&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="kt"&gt;void&lt;/span&gt; &lt;span class="nf"&gt;setLanguage&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;this&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;language&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;;&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;

    &lt;span class="nd"&gt;@Override&lt;/span&gt;
    &lt;span class="kd"&gt;public&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="nf"&gt;toString&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;format&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;
            &lt;span class="s"&gt;"TranslateResponse{originalText='%s', translatedText='%s', language='%s'}"&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t;
            &lt;span class="n"&gt;originalText&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="n"&gt;translatedText&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="n"&gt;language&lt;/span&gt;&lt;span class="o"&gt;);&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;
&lt;span class="o"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The &lt;code&gt;@JsonPropertyDescription&lt;/code&gt; annotations are key, Genkit passes them to Gemini as part of the JSON schema, so the model knows exactly what each field means.&lt;/p&gt;

&lt;h3&gt;
  
  
  Step 2: Initialize Genkit
&lt;/h3&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ight java"&gt;&lt;code&gt;&lt;span class="nc"&gt;Genkit&lt;/span&gt; &lt;span class="n"&gt;genkit&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nc"&gt;Genkit&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;builder&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;options&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;GenkitOptions&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;builder&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
        &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;devMode&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="kc"&gt;true&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
        &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;reflectionPort&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="mi"&gt;3100&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
        &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;build&lt;/span&gt;&lt;span class="o"&gt;())&lt;/span&gt;
    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;plugin&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;GoogleGenAIPlugin&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;create&lt;/span&gt;&lt;span class="o"&gt;())&lt;/span&gt;
    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;plugin&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;jetty&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;build&lt;/span&gt;&lt;span class="o"&gt;();&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;That's the entire setup. The &lt;code&gt;GoogleGenAIPlugin&lt;/code&gt; reads your &lt;code&gt;GOOGLE_API_KEY&lt;/code&gt; automatically. The &lt;code&gt;JettyPlugin&lt;/code&gt; handles HTTP. Genkit wires everything together.&lt;/p&gt;

&lt;h3&gt;
  
  
  Step 3: Define a Flow with Typed Classes and Structured Output
&lt;/h3&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ight java"&gt;&lt;code&gt;&lt;span class="n"&gt;genkit&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;defineFlow&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;
    &lt;span class="s"&gt;"translate"&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t;
    &lt;span class="nc"&gt;TranslateRequest&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;class&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t;     &lt;span class="c1"&gt;// ← typed input&lt;/span&gt;
    &lt;span class="nc"&gt;TranslateResponse&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;class&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t;    &lt;span class="c1"&gt;// ← typed output&lt;/span&gt;
    &l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;ctx&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t; &lt;span class="n"&gt;request&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t; &lt;span class="o"&gt;-&amp;gt;&lt;/span&gt; &lt;span class="o"&gt;{&lt;/span&gt;
        &lt;span class="nc"&gt;String&lt;/span&gt; &lt;span class="n"&gt;prompt&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nc"&gt;String&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;format&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;
            &lt;span class="s"&gt;"Translate the following text to %s.\n\nText: %s"&lt;/span&gt;&lt;span class="o"&gt;,&lt;/span&gt;
            &lt;span class="n"&gt;request&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;getLanguage&lt;/span&gt;&lt;span class="o"&gt;(),&lt;/span&gt; &lt;span class="n"&gt;request&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;getText&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
        &lt;span class="o"&gt;);&lt;/span&gt;

        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;genkit&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;generate&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;
            &lt;span class="nc"&gt;GenerateOptions&lt;/span&gt;&lt;span class="o"&gt;.&amp;lt;&lt;/span&gt;&lt;span class="nc"&gt;TranslateResponse&lt;/span&gt;&lt;span class="o"&gt;&amp;gt;&lt;/span&gt;&lt;span class="n"&gt;builder&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
                &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;model&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="s"&gt;"googleai/gemini-3-flash-preview"&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
                &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;prompt&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="n"&gt;prompt&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
                &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;outputClass&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;TranslateResponse&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;class&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;  &lt;span class="c1"&gt;// ← Gemini returns a typed object!&lt;/span&gt;
                &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;config&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="nc"&gt;GenerationConfig&lt;/span&gt;&l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;builder&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
                    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;temperature&lt;/span&gt;&lt;span class="o"&gt;(&lt;/span&gt;&lt;span class="mf"&gt;0.1&lt;/span&gt;&lt;span class="o"&gt;)&lt;/span&gt;
                    &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;build&lt;/span&gt;&lt;span class="o"&gt;())&lt;/span&gt;
                &lt;span class="o"&gt;.&lt;/span&gt;&lt;span class="na"&gt;build&lt;/span&gt;&lt;span class="o"&gt;()&lt;/span&gt;
        &lt;span class="o"&gt;);&lt;/span&gt;
    &lt;span class="o"&gt;}&lt;/span&gt;
&lt;span class="o"&gt;);&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Look at what's happening here: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;
&lt;strong&gt;&lt;code&gt;TranslateRequest.class&lt;/code&gt;&lt;/strong&gt; as the flow input, Genkit automatically deserializes incoming JSON into a &lt;code&gt;TranslateRequest&lt;/code&gt; object. No &lt;code&gt;Map.get()&lt;/code&gt; casting.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;&lt;code&gt;TranslateResponse.class&lt;/code&gt;&lt;/strong&gt; as the flow output, the flow returns a typed object, serialized automatically to JSON for the HTTP response.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;&lt;code&gt;outputClass(TranslateResponse.class)&lt;/code&gt;&lt;/strong&gt; on the &lt;code&gt;generate&lt;/code&gt; call, this is the magic. Genkit sends the JSON schema derived from &lt;code&gt;TranslateResponse&lt;/code&gt; to Gemini, and Gemini returns structured JSON that Genkit deserializes into a &lt;code&gt;TranslateResponse&lt;/code&gt; object. No &lt;code&gt;response.getText()&lt;/code&gt; + manual parsing.&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;That single &lt;code&gt;defineFlow&lt;/code&gt; call: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Registers the flow in Genkit's internal registry&lt;/li&gt;
&lt;li&gt;Exposes it as a &lt;code&gt;POST /api/flows/translate&lt;/code&gt; HTTP endpoint&lt;/li&gt;
&lt;li&gt;Makes it visible in the Dev UI&lt;/li&gt;
&lt;li&gt;Adds full OpenTelemetry tracing automatically&lt;/li&gt;
&lt;li&gt;Tracks token usage, latency, and error rates&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;Compare that to writing a Spring Boot controller + service + DTO + config + exception handler for the same functionality.&lt;/p&gt;

&lt;h2&gt;
  
  
  Deploying to Google Cloud Run
&lt;/h2&gt;

&lt;p&gt;The project uses &lt;strong&gt;&lt;a href="https://github.com/GoogleContainerTools/jib" rel="noopener noreferrer"&gt;Jib&lt;/a&gt;&lt;/strong&gt; to build and push container images directly from Maven, &lt;strong&gt;no Dockerfile and no Docker daemon required&lt;/strong&gt;. Jib is configured in the &lt;code&gt;pom.xml&lt;/code&gt; and builds optimized, layered container images.&lt;/p&gt;

&lt;h3&gt;
  
  
  Step-by-Step Deployment
&lt;/h3&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;&lt;span class="c"&gt;# Set your GCP project&lt;/span&gt;
&lt;span class="nb"&gt;export &lt;/span&gt;&lt;span class="nv"&gt;PROJECT_ID&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="si"&gt;$(&lt;/span&gt;gcloud config get-value project&lt;span class="si"&gt;)&lt;/span&gt;
&lt;span class="nb"&gt;export &lt;/span&gt;&lt;span class="nv"&gt;REGION&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;us-central1

&lt;span class="c"&gt;# Build the container image and push it to Google Container Registry&lt;/span&gt;
&lt;span class="c"&gt;# No Docker needed, Jib does it all from Maven!&lt;/span&gt;
mvn compile jib:build &lt;span class="nt"&gt;-Djib&lt;/span&gt;.to.image&lt;span class="o"&gt;=&lt;/span&gt;gcr.io/&lt;span class="nv"&gt;$PROJECT_ID&lt;/span&gt;/genkit-java-app

&lt;span class="c"&gt;# Deploy to Cloud Run&lt;/span&gt;
gcloud run deploy genkit-java-app &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--image&lt;/span&gt; gcr.io/&lt;span class="nv"&gt;$PROJECT_ID&lt;/span&gt;/genkit-java-app &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--region&lt;/span&gt; &lt;span class="nv"&gt;$REGION&lt;/span&gt; &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--platform&lt;/span&gt; managed &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--allow-unauthenticated&lt;/span&gt; &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--set-env-vars&lt;/span&gt; &lt;span class="s2"&gt;"GOOGLE_API_KEY=&lt;/span&gt;&lt;span class="nv"&gt;$GOOGLE_API_KEY&lt;/span&gt;&lt;span class="s2"&gt;"&lt;/span&gt; &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--memory&lt;/span&gt; 512Mi &lt;span class="se"&gt;\&lt;/span&gt;
  &lt;span class="nt"&gt;--cpu&lt;/span&gt; 1
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Two commands. No Docker. Your Java GenAI application is now live on a globally-distributed, auto-scaling, serverless platform.&lt;/p&gt;

&lt;h3&gt;
  
  
  Why Jib?
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;No Dockerfile&lt;/strong&gt;, Container image is built directly from your Maven project&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;No Docker daemon&lt;/strong&gt;, Doesn't require Docker installed or running on your machine&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Fast rebuilds&lt;/strong&gt;, Separates dependencies, classes, and resources into layers, so only changed layers are rebuilt&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Reproducible&lt;/strong&gt;, Builds are deterministic and don't depend on the local Docker environment&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Direct push&lt;/strong&gt;, Sends the image straight to GCR/Artifact Registry without a local &lt;code&gt;docker push&lt;/code&gt;
&lt;/li&gt;
&lt;/ul&gt;

      <description>&lt;p&gt;En el Alexa Live 2020, el equipo de Amazon Alexa lanzó una funcionalidad llamada Alexa Entities. Esta funcionalidad tiene como objetivo utilizar el Alexa Graph Knowledge para recuperar información adicional de algunos built-in slots como por ejemplo de lugares, actores, personas, etc. Después de un año, esta funcionalidad se ha lanzado en más locales, incluidos español, alemán, francés e italiano. Con Alexa Entities, no necesitas acceder a una API externa para obtener datos adicionales. Cada entity proporcionará una URL del grafo de conocimiento de Alexa donde podrás obtener esa información extra.&lt;/p&gt;

&lt;h2&gt;
  
  
  Prerrequisitos
&lt;/h2&gt;

&lt;p&gt;Aquí tienes las tecnologías utilizadas en este proyecto: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Node.js v14.x&lt;/li&gt;
&lt;li&gt;Visual Studio Code&lt;/li&gt;
&lt;li&gt;Extensión de Alexa para VS Code&lt;/li&gt;
&lt;/ol&gt;

&lt;h2&gt;
  
  
  Configurando nuestra Skill de Alexa
&lt;/h2&gt;

&lt;p&gt;Como he señalado más arriba, cuando agregamos un built-in slot en nuestro modelo de interacción, por ejemplo &lt;code&gt;AMAZON.Actor&lt;/code&gt;, y ese slot se matchea con lo que ha dicho el usuario, recibiremos en nuestra AWS Lambda dos cosas.&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Primero que este slot se ha matcheado &lt;/li&gt;
&lt;li&gt;Segundo, algo de información adicional.&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;Esa información adicional será la resolución del slot como una Alexa entity. ¿Qué es esa información? Será un enlace donde podemos obtener todos los datos de esa Alexa entity que se ha matcheado. Este enlace tiene una forma parecida al siguiente: &lt;code&gt;https://ld.amazonalexa.com/entity/v1/KmHs1W4gVQDE9HHq72eDLs&lt;/code&gt;&lt;/p&gt;

&lt;p&gt;Debido a esto, necesitamos configurar nuestro backend de la Alexa Skill. Como vamos a buscar algunos datos en el Alexa Knowledge Graph, el primer paso que debemos hacer es agregar un paquete npm: &lt;code&gt;axios&lt;/code&gt;&lt;/p&gt;

&lt;p&gt;Para instalar esta dependencia, tenemos ejecutar estos comandos: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Para npm:
&lt;/li&gt;
&lt;/ol&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;    npm &lt;span class="nb"&gt;install&lt;/span&gt; &lt;span class="nt"&gt;--save&lt;/span&gt; axios
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;ol&gt;
&lt;li&gt;Para yarn:
&lt;/li&gt;
&lt;/ol&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;    yarn add axios
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Axios es una de las librerías más comunes que se utilizan en Node.js para realizar solicitudes HTTP.&lt;/p&gt;

&lt;p&gt;¡Con este paquete instalado/actualizado, ya casi tenemos el setup necesario! Continuemos con los siguientes pasos.&lt;/p&gt;

&lt;h2&gt;
  
  
  Resolución de las Alexa Entities
&lt;/h2&gt;

&lt;p&gt;Como se explica en la documentación oficial: "Cada Entity es un nodo vinculado a otras Entities en el grafo de conocimiento".&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--mE2_7qB8--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/knowledge_graph.jpeg"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--mE2_7qB8--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/knowledge_graph.jpeg" alt="Full-width image" width="800" height="450"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Así que volvamos a nuestro ejemplo, el del &lt;code&gt;AMAZON.Actor&lt;/code&gt;. Imagina que tenemos un slot llamado &lt;code&gt;actor&lt;/code&gt; que usa ese tipo de built-in slot. Cuando solicitamos información de un actor y ese actor coincide con el slot y también ese actor existe en el grafo de conocimiento de Alexa, obtendremos una URL para obtener sus datos.&lt;/p&gt;

&lt;p&gt;Pero, ¿dónde podemos encontrar esa URL? ¿Dónde se encuentra esa información dentro de la request? Esto es lo que Alexa llama &lt;strong&gt;Slot resolution&lt;/strong&gt;. El Slot resolution es la forma en que Alexa nos dice, como desarrolladores, que un slot ha matchaedo con éxito y cuál es la authority que resolvió el valor de ese slot. Por ejemplo, un slot puede resolverse mediante estas 3 authorities: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Como &lt;strong&gt;Custom value&lt;/strong&gt;. Por ejemplo, un actor que agregamos manualmente.&lt;/li&gt;
&lt;li&gt;Como &lt;strong&gt;Dynamic entity&lt;/strong&gt;. Los valores personalizados que podemos agregar mediante código.&lt;/li&gt;
&lt;li&gt;Como &lt;strong&gt;Alexa entity&lt;/strong&gt;. Cuando el actor existe en el grafo de conocimiento de Alexa.&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;Las Slot resolution authorities y sus resoluciones se pueden encontrar dentro de la request aquí: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--lNTHjQEA--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/entity_resolution.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--lNTHjQEA--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/entity_resolution.png" alt="Full-width image" width="559" height="532"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;En este ejemplo, cuando obtenemos los datos, vemos algunas propiedades como &lt;code&gt;birthdate&lt;/code&gt;, &lt;code&gt;birthplace&lt;/code&gt; o un array llamado &lt;code&gt;child&lt;/code&gt;. Este array contiene el hijo o los hijos del actor que hemos solicitado. En cada objeto del array &lt;code&gt;child&lt;/code&gt; encontraremos una URL donde podemos obtener los datos de cada hijo.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--cCS87ldz--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/entity_graph.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--cCS87ldz--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/entity_graph.png" alt="Full-width image" width="545" height="366"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Es importante señalar aquí que cada entity tiene su propio esquema. Se explican todos los tipos &lt;a href="https://developer.amazon.com/en-US/docs/alexa/custom-skills/alexa-entities-reference.html#entity-classes-and-properties"&gt;aquí&lt;/a&gt;.&lt;/p&gt;

&lt;h2&gt;
  
  
  Jugando con Alexa Entities
&lt;/h2&gt;

&lt;p&gt;Una vez que tenemos los paquetes que necesitamos instalados/actualizados y entendemos la resolución de las Alexa Entities y cómo funciona, necesitamos modificar nuestro AWS Lambda para jugar con las Alexa Entities.&lt;/p&gt;

&lt;p&gt;Para este ejemplo, he creado un intent para obtener información de los actores: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--Dkoi5YdB--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/intent.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--Dkoi5YdB--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/intent.png" alt="Full-width image" width="800" height="570"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;El slot &lt;code&gt;actor&lt;/code&gt; está usando el built-in slot &lt;code&gt;AMAZON.Actor&lt;/code&gt;: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--ip4uDKD---/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/slot.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--ip4uDKD---/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/slot.png" alt="Full-width image" width="800" height="305"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Luego tenemos un handler para este intent llamado &lt;code&gt;EntityIntentHandler&lt;/code&gt;. Lo primero que va a hacer este controlador es verificar si el slot &lt;code&gt;actor&lt;/code&gt; se ha matchaedo exitósamente y si se ha resuelto como una Alexa Entity: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;actor&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;Alexa&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;getSlot&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;handlerInput&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;requestEnvelope&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;actor&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;resolutions&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;getSlotResolutions&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;actor&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Esta es la función &lt;code&gt;getSlotResolutions&lt;/code&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="kd"&gt;function&lt;/span&gt; &lt;span class="nx"&gt;getSlotResolutions&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;slot&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="nx"&gt;slot&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;resolutions&lt;/span&gt;
        &lt;span class="o"&gt;&amp;amp;&amp;amp;&lt;/span&gt; &lt;span class="nx"&gt;slot&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;resolutions&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;resolutionsPerAuthority&lt;/span&gt;
        &lt;span class="o"&gt;&amp;amp;&amp;amp;&lt;/span&gt; &lt;span class="nx"&gt;slot&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;resolutions&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;resolutionsPerAuthority&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;find&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;resolutionMatch&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="kd"&gt;function&lt;/span&gt; &lt;span class="nx"&gt;resolutionMatch&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;resolution&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="nx"&gt;resolution&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;authority&lt;/span&gt; &lt;span class="o"&gt;===&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;AlexaEntities&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
        &lt;span class="o"&gt;&amp;amp;&amp;amp;&lt;/span&gt; &lt;span class="nx"&gt;resolution&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;status&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;code&lt;/span&gt; &lt;span class="o"&gt;===&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;ER_SUCCESS_MATCH&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Cuando tenemos el slot y se resuelve con éxito como una Alexa Entity, necesitamos obtener un token. Este token se incluye en cada request. Para eso solo necesitas llamar a esta función: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;apiAccessToken&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;Alexa&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;getApiAccessToken&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;handlerInput&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;requestEnvelope&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Ten en cuenta que el objeto &lt;code&gt;Alexa&lt;/code&gt; es el objeto que obtuvimos al importar la biblioteca &lt;code&gt;ask-sdk-core&lt;/code&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;Alexa&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;require&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;ask-sdk-core&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Con toda esta información, podemos llamar al grafo de conocimiento de Alexa usando &lt;code&gt;axios&lt;/code&gt; (asegúrate de que ya lo has importado):&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;entityURL&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;resolutions&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;values&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;].&lt;/span&gt;&lt;span class="nx"&gt;value&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;id&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;headers&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Authorization&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="s2"&gt;`Bearer &lt;/span&gt;&lt;span class="p"&gt;${&lt;/span&gt;&lt;span class="nx"&gt;apiAccessToken&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="s2"&gt;`&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
    &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Accept-Language&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;Alexa&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;getLocale&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;handlerInput&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;requestEnvelope&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="p"&gt;};&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;response&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="nx"&gt;axios&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="kd"&gt;get&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;entityURL&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="na"&gt;headers&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nx"&gt;headers&lt;/span&gt; &lt;span class="p"&gt;});&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Es importante agregar el locale para obtener los datos en el idioma adecuado.&lt;/p&gt;

&lt;p&gt;Si la request ha ido bien, podemos preparar nuestra string que vamos a devolver a Alexa usando los datos del Alexa Knowledge Graph: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;response&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;status&lt;/span&gt; &lt;span class="o"&gt;===&lt;/span&gt; &lt;span class="mi"&gt;200&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;entity&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;response&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;data&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;birthplace&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;birthplace&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;name&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;][&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@value&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;birthdate&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nb"&gt;Date&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nb"&gt;Date&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;parse&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;birthdate&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@value&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;])).&lt;/span&gt;&lt;span class="nx"&gt;getFullYear&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;childsNumber&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;child&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;length&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;occupation&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;occupation&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;].&lt;/span&gt;&lt;span class="nx"&gt;name&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;][&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@value&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;awards&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;totalNumberOfAwards&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;][&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@value&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
    &l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;name&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t;  &lt;span class="nx"&gt;entity&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;name&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="mi"&gt;0&lt;/span&gt;&lt;span class="p"&gt;][&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@value&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
    &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;Alexa&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;getLocale&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;handlerInput&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;requestEnvelope&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nx"&gt;indexOf&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;es&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="o"&gt;!=&lt;/span&gt; &lt;span class="o"&gt;-&lt;/span&gt;&lt;span class="mi"&gt;1&lt;/span&gt;&lt;span class="p"&gt;){&lt;/span&gt;
        &lt;span class="nx"&gt;speakOutput&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;name&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; nació en &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;birthplace&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; en &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;birthdate&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; y tiene &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;childsNumber&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; hijos. Actualmente trabaja como &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;occupation&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;. Tiene un total de &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;awards&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; premios.&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
    &l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="k"&gt;else&l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;
        &lt;span class="nx"&gt;speakOutput&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;name&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; was borned in &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;birthplace&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; in &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;birthdate&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; and has &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;childsNumber&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; children. Now is working as a &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;occupation&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;. Has won &l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="nx"&gt;awards&lt;/span&gt; &lt;span class="o"&gt;+&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t; awards.&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
    &lt;span class="p"&gt;}&lt;/span&gt;

&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="k"&gt;else&l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;Alexa&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;getLocale&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;handlerInput&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;requestEnvelope&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nx"&gt;indexOf&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;es&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="o"&gt;!=&lt;/span&gt; &lt;span class="o"&gt;-&lt;/span&gt;&lt;span class="mi"&gt;1&lt;/span&gt;&lt;span class="p"&gt;){&lt;/span&gt;
        &lt;span class="nx"&gt;speakOutput&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;No he encontrado informacion sobre ese actor.&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
    &l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="k"&gt;else&l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;
        &lt;span class="nx"&gt;speakOutput&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;Didnt find information about that actor.&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
    &lt;span class="p"&gt;}&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Y este es el resultado final: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--2JnKWHrk--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/execution_es.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--2JnKWHrk--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_800/https://xavidop.me/assets/img/blog/tutorials/alexa-entities/execution_es.png" alt="Full-width image" width="800" height="407"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;h2&gt;
  
  
  ¿Qué Alexa Entities están disponibles?
&lt;/h2&gt;

&lt;p&gt;Es importante decir que no todas los built-in slots de Alexa están enlazados a Alexa Entities. Depende del locale y del built-in slot en sí. Para asegurarte de cuáles están disponibles, puedes consultar la &lt;a href="https://developer.amazon.com/en-US/docs/alexa/custom-skills/alexa-entities-reference.html#bist-er-support"&gt;documentación oficial&lt;/a&gt;.&lt;/p&gt;

      <description>&lt;h3&gt;
  
  
  My Workflow
&lt;/h3&gt;

&lt;p&gt;"DevOps is the union of people, process, and products to enable continuous delivery of value to our end users." - Donovan Brown, Microsoft&lt;/p&gt;

&lt;p&gt;DevOps is a "culture" which have a set of practices that combines software development (Dev) and information-technology operations (Ops) which aims to shorten the systems development life cycle and provide continuous delivery with high software quality. DevOps culture develops "production-first mindset". &lt;br&gt;
In terms of Alexa, DevOps can help us to quickly ship the highest quality of our Skill to the end customers.&lt;br&gt;
This post contains materials from different resources that can be seen on Resources section.&lt;/p&gt;
&lt;h4&gt;
  
  
  Prerequisites
&lt;/h4&gt;

&lt;p&gt;Here you have the technologies used in this project&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Amazon Developer Account - &lt;a href="http://developer.amazon.com/"&gt;How to get it&lt;/a&gt;
&lt;/li&gt;
&lt;li&gt;AWS Account - &lt;a href="https://aws.amazon.com/"&gt;Sign up here for free&lt;/a&gt;
&lt;/li&gt;
&lt;li&gt;ASK CLI - &lt;a href="https://developer.amazon.com/es-ES/docs/alexa/smapi/quick-start-alexa-skills-kit-command-line-interface.html"&gt;Install and configure ASK CLI&lt;/a&gt;
&lt;/li&gt;
&lt;li&gt;GitHub Account -  &lt;a href="https://github.com/"&gt;Sign up here&lt;/a&gt;
&lt;/li&gt;
&lt;li&gt;Visual Studio Code&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;The Alexa Skills Kit Command Line Interface (ASK CLI) is a tool for you to manage your Alexa skills and related resources, such as AWS Lambda functions.&lt;br&gt;
With ASK CLI, you have access to the Skill Management API, which allows you to manage Alexa skills programmatically from the command line.&lt;br&gt;
If you want how to create your Skill with the ASK CLI, please follow the first step explained in my &lt;a href="https://github.com/xavidop/alexa-nodejs-lambda-helloworld"&gt;Node.js Skill sample&lt;/a&gt;. &lt;br&gt;
We are going to use this powerful tool to do some steps in our pipeline. Let's DevOps!&lt;/p&gt;
&lt;h4&gt;
  
  
  Pipeline
&lt;/h4&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--acHrbmbg--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://github.com/xavidop/alexa-nodejs-lambda-helloworld-v2/raw/master/img/pipeline.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--acHrbmbg--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://github.com/xavidop/alexa-nodejs-lambda-helloworld-v2/raw/master/img/pipeline.png" alt="image"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Let's explain job by job what is happening in our powerful pipeline. &lt;br&gt;
First of all, each box on the left represented in the image above is a job and they will be defined below the &lt;code&gt;jobs&lt;/code&gt; node in the GitHub Actions Workflow configuration file:&lt;/p&gt;
&lt;h5&gt;
  
  
  Checkout
&lt;/h5&gt;

&lt;p&gt;The checkout job will execute the following tasks: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Checkout the code &lt;/li&gt;
&lt;li&gt;Bring execution permission to be able to execute all the tests
&lt;/li&gt;
&lt;/ol&gt;
&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ight yaml"&gt;&lt;code&gt;  &lt;span class="na"&gt;checkout&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="na"&gt;runs-on&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;ubuntu-latest&lt;/span&gt;
    &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Checkout&lt;/span&gt;
    &lt;span class="na"&gt;steps&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
      &lt;span class="c1"&gt;# To use this repository's private action,&lt;/span&gt;
      &lt;span class="c1"&gt;# you must check out the repository&lt;/span&gt;
      &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Checkout&lt;/span&gt;
        &lt;span class="na"&gt;uses&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;actions/checkout@v2&lt;/span&gt;
      &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;run&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;|&lt;/span&gt;
          &lt;span class="s"&gt;chmod +x -R ./test;&lt;/span&gt;
          &lt;span class="s"&gt;ls -la&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;

&lt;h5&gt;
  
  
  Build
&lt;/h5&gt;

&lt;p&gt;The build job will execute the following tasks: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Checkout the code.&lt;/li&gt;
&lt;li&gt;Run &lt;code&gt;npm install&lt;/code&gt; in order to download all the Node.js dependencies, including dev dependencies.
&lt;/li&gt;
&lt;/ol&gt;
&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ight yaml"&gt;&lt;code&gt;  &lt;span class="na"&gt;build&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="na"&gt;runs-on&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;ubuntu-latest&lt;/span&gt;
    &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Build&lt;/span&gt;
    &lt;span class="na"&gt;needs&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;checkout&lt;/span&gt;
    &lt;span class="na"&gt;steps&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
      &lt;span class="c1"&gt;# To use this repository's private action,&lt;/span&gt;
      &lt;span class="c1"&gt;# you must check out the repository&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Checkout&lt;/span&gt;
      &lt;span class="na"&gt;uses&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;actions/checkout@v2&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;run&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;|&lt;/span&gt;
        &lt;span class="s"&gt;cd lambda;&lt;/span&gt;
        &lt;span class="s"&gt;npm install&lt;/span&gt;

&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;

&lt;h5&gt;
  
  
  Pretests
&lt;/h5&gt;
